当前位置: 首页 > 产品大全 > DNS系统 计算机系统中不可或缺的服务架构

DNS系统 计算机系统中不可或缺的服务架构

DNS系统 计算机系统中不可或缺的服务架构

在当今互联网时代,DNS(域名系统)作为计算机系统的核心服务之一,扮演着将用户友好的域名转换为机器可读的IP地址的关键角色。它不仅是网络通信的基石,更是确保互联网高效、稳定运行的重要保障。

DNS系统的基本功能在于实现域名与IP地址之间的映射。当用户在浏览器中输入如“www.example.com”这样的域名时,DNS服务会将其解析为相应的IP地址(例如192.0.2.1),使得计算机能够准确找到目标服务器并建立连接。这一过程虽然对用户透明,但其背后涉及复杂的查询机制和分布式数据库结构。

从架构上看,DNS采用层次化的分布式设计,主要包括根域名服务器、顶级域名服务器(如.com、.org)、权威域名服务器和本地域名服务器。这种分层结构不仅提高了系统的可扩展性和可靠性,还通过缓存机制显著减少了查询延迟,优化了网络性能。

作为计算机系统服务,DNS通常以后台进程或服务的形态运行在操作系统层面。在Windows系统中,DNS客户端服务(DNS Client)负责缓存DNS查询结果以加速后续访问;在Linux系统中,则可通过如systemd-resolved或dnsmasq等工具进行配置和管理。企业级环境中,常部署专用的DNS服务器(如BIND、PowerDNS)以提供更强大的解析能力和安全控制。

值得注意的是,DNS服务的安全性日益受到关注。常见的威胁包括DNS劫持、缓存投毒和DDoS攻击。为此,业界推广了DNSSEC(DNS安全扩展)技术,通过数字签名验证数据的真实性和完整性。DoH(DNS over HTTPS)和DoT(DNS over TLS)等加密协议的应用,进一步保护了查询隐私,防止窃听和篡改。

随着云计算和物联网的快速发展,DNS系统也在不断演进。智能DNS可以根据用户地理位置或网络状况返回最优的IP地址,提升访问速度;而边缘计算中的分布式DNS则有助于降低延迟,改善用户体验。DNS可能会与人工智能结合,实现更智能的流量调度和威胁检测。

DNS系统作为计算机系统服务的核心组成部分,其稳定与安全直接关系到整个互联网的畅通。无论是普通用户还是企业管理员,理解DNS的基本原理和最佳实践,对于构建高效、可靠的网络环境都具有重要意义。

如若转载,请注明出处:http://www.377taoke.com/product/36.html

更新时间:2026-01-13 00:24:40